add dom element javascript code example
Example 1: create element javascript with id
var btn = document.createElement('div');
btn.setAttribute("id", "div1");
Example 2: add element to body javascript
var elem = document.createElement('div');
elem.style.cssText = 'position:absolute;width:100%;height:100%;opacity:0.3;z-index:100;background:#000';
document.body.appendChild(elem);
Example 3: insert element to dom
var node = document.createElement("LI"); // Create a <li> node
var textnode = document.createTextNode("Water"); // Create a text node
node.appendChild(textnode); // Append the text to <li>
document.getElementById("myList").appendChild(node); // Append <li> to <ul> with id="myList"
Example 4: how to add elements in javascript html
//adding 'p' tag to body
var tag = document.createElement("p"); // <p></p>
var text = document.createTextNode("TEST TEXT");
tag.appendChild(text); // <p>TEST TEXT</p>
var element = document.getElementsByTagName("body")[0];
element.appendChild(tag); // <body> <p>TEST TEXT</p> </body>
Example 5: add a child html object to another html object in js
//Add child at end of object children list
parent.append(child);
//Add child at start of object children list
parent.insertBefore(child, list.childNodes[0]);